Your rights when shopping with Aish, including made-to-order items, ready-to-wear returns and faulty goods.
Most Aish pieces are made to order and cut to your individual measurements and specifications. Under the Consumer Contracts (Information, Cancellation and Additional Charges) Regulations 2013, Regulation 28(1)(b), goods made to the consumer's specification or clearly personalised are exempt from the 14-day cooling-off period.
Customized items cannot be returned or refunded once production has started. This includes pieces made to your measurements, with bespoke design notes, colour or embroidery requests, or any other personal specifications. Because the work is carried out specifically for you, we cannot reverse the stitching, reuse the materials, or resell the garment to another client.
However, if production has not yet started, we may be able to accommodate a cancellation as a goodwill gesture. Please contact us on WhatsApp as soon as possible with your order number.
If you purchase a ready-to-wear item (not made to your measurements or specifications), you have a 14-day cooling-off period starting from the day after you receive the item. This is your right under the Consumer Contracts (Information, Cancellation and Additional Charges) Regulations 2013.
